Yeah I wonder if they'll change Nibelheim to Niflheim too.

Probably not. Nibelheim is deliberately spelled that way in Japanese (ニブルハイム niburuhaimu) vs Niflheim (ニフルハイム nifuruhaimu). Just like Midgar deliberately dropped the 'd' in Japanese (ミッドガル middogaru vs ミッドガード middoga-do).

What about the Midgar Zolom?

Just Andi Now
Nov 8, 2009


RatHat posted:

What about the Midgar Zolom?

Can't find any standard transliteration of Midgardsormr, but the one in game is spelled kind of like Midgar's Worm (ミドガルズオルム midogaruzuorumu), and this is the same spelling used in subsequent FF games, so it's either the standard transliteration or Square's just sticking with it because of FFVII.
